Patents by Inventor Martin Weston

Martin Weston has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11587081
    Abstract: Fuel dispensing transactions may be accomplished by a variety of systems and techniques. A fuel dispensing device may include a payment module, a data entry device, and a customer display. The payment module may receive a first communication from a point of sale device requesting an encrypted response and receive a second communication from the point of sale device requesting an unencrypted response. The module may match the first communication to a first corresponding library entry, match the second communication to a second corresponding library entry, determine a user response based on one of the first corresponding library entry or the second corresponding library entry, where the user response defines one of the encrypted response based on the first corresponding library entry or the unencrypted response based on the second corresponding library entry, and use the corresponding library entry to generate a visual customer display requesting the user response.
    Type: Grant
    Filed: July 2, 2015
    Date of Patent: February 21, 2023
    Assignee: Wayne Fueling Systems LLC
    Inventors: Timothy Martin Weston, Weiming Tang
  • Patent number: 10687076
    Abstract: In video motion estimation an initial candidate motion vector is generated for each block and a vector error is determined as for example a DFD. Spatial gradients of pixel values are calculated and used to refine the initial candidate motion vector. The relative contribution of the spatial gradients to the refinement process depends on the vector error.
    Type: Grant
    Filed: February 23, 2018
    Date of Patent: June 16, 2020
    Assignee: GRASS VALLEY LIMITED
    Inventors: Michael James Knee, Martin Weston
  • Patent number: 10558961
    Abstract: This disclosure provides various embodiments of systems and methods for secure communications. In one aspect, the system includes a secure payment module (SPM) in a fuel dispenser and a point-of-sale (POS) system. The POS system stores a public key certificate uniquely identifying the SPM and is configured to dynamically generate a first session key. The POS system encrypts the first session key with a public key associated with the public key certificate, and transmits the encrypted first session key to the SPM. The SPM, which stores a private key associated with the public key certificate, is configured to receive and decrypt the first session key. The SPM is further configured to receive a set of magnetic card data from a card reader, encrypt the set of magnetic card data with the first session key, and transmit the encrypted set of magnetic card data to the POS system.
    Type: Grant
    Filed: October 18, 2007
    Date of Patent: February 11, 2020
    Assignee: Wayne Fueling Systems LLC
    Inventors: Weiming Tang, Timothy Martin Weston
  • Publication number: 20180184115
    Abstract: In video motion estimation an initial candidate motion vector is generated for each block and a vector error is determined as for example a DFD. Spatial gradients of pixel values are calculated and used to refine the initial candidate motion vector. The relative contribution of the spatial gradients to the refinement process depends on the vector error.
    Type: Application
    Filed: February 23, 2018
    Publication date: June 28, 2018
    Applicant: Snell Advanced Media Limited
    Inventors: Michael James Knee, Martin Weston
  • Patent number: 9911266
    Abstract: A multimode system for receiving data in a retail environment includes: a secure input module for receiving high security input and low security input from a customer, the high security input to be communicated by the secure input module in cipher text, and the low security input to be communicated by the secure input module in plaintext. The multimode system is adapted to operate in a high security mode and a low security mode. The multimode system is adapted to enter the low security mode upon detection by the multimode system of a security breach condition. In the high security mode, the secure input module accepts low security input and high security input. In the low security mode, the secure input module accepts the low security input and does not accept the high security input.
    Type: Grant
    Filed: June 6, 2014
    Date of Patent: March 6, 2018
    Assignee: Wayne Fueling Systems LLC
    Inventors: Timothy Martin Weston, Weiming Tang, David Spiller
  • Publication number: 20170085912
    Abstract: An array of pixel-to-pixel dissimilarity values is analysed to select a pixel which has a low pixel-to-pixel dissimilarity value and which has neighbouring pixels which have a low pixel-to-pixel dissimilarity value. Each pixel-to-pixel dissimilarity value represents a difference between the value of a pixel in a first spatial pixel array representing a first image and the value of a corresponding pixel in a second spatial pixel array representing a second image. The pixels neighbouring the current pixel are divided into at least two polar sectors. The current pixel is selected when the current pixel and the pixels of at least one polar sector have low dissimilarity values.
    Type: Application
    Filed: December 2, 2016
    Publication date: March 23, 2017
    Inventors: Michael James Knee, Martin Weston
  • Patent number: 9532053
    Abstract: In for example the assignment of motion vectors, an array of pixel-to-pixel dissimilarity values is analyzed to identify a pixel which has a low pixel-to-pixel dissimilarity value and which has neighboring pixels which have a low pixel-to-pixel dissimilarity value. The pixel-to-pixel dissimilarity values are filtered with a filter aperture decomposed into two or more sectors with partial filters applied respectively to each sector. Outputs of the partial filters are combining by a non-linear operation, for example taking the minimum from diametrically opposed sectors.
    Type: Grant
    Filed: March 15, 2013
    Date of Patent: December 27, 2016
    Assignee: Snell Limited
    Inventors: Michael James Knee, Martin Weston
  • Patent number: 9214052
    Abstract: A method of identifying the left-eye and the right-eye images of a stereoscopic pair, comprising the steps of comparing the images to locate an occluded region visible in only one of the images; detecting image edges; and identifying a right-eye image where image edges are aligned with a left hand edge of an occluded region and identifying a left-eye image where more image edges are aligned with a right hand edge of an occluded region.
    Type: Grant
    Filed: March 18, 2011
    Date of Patent: December 15, 2015
    Assignee: Snell Limited
    Inventors: Michael James Knee, Martin Weston
  • Patent number: 9131126
    Abstract: A method for repairing scratch impairments in which brightness values for a set of points within a narrow region of the impaired input image that is aligned with an expected scratch direction are modified in a scratch repair process; and the scratch repair process is controlled in dependence upon the relationship between the impaired brightness values and corresponding modified brightness values.
    Type: Grant
    Filed: April 8, 2011
    Date of Patent: September 8, 2015
    Assignee: Snell Limited
    Inventor: Martin Weston
  • Patent number: 9087427
    Abstract: Fuel dispensing transactions may be accomplished by a variety of systems and techniques. A fuel dispensing device may include a payment module, a data entry device, and a customer display. The payment module may receive a first communication from a point of sale device requesting an encrypted response and receive a second communication from the point of sale device requesting an unencrypted response. The module may match the first communication to a first corresponding library entry, match the second communication to a second corresponding library entry, determine a user response based on one of the first corresponding library entry or the second corresponding library entry, where the user response defines one of the encrypted response based on the first corresponding library entry or the unencrypted response based on the second corresponding library entry, and use the corresponding library entry to generate a visual customer display requesting the user response.
    Type: Grant
    Filed: September 27, 2007
    Date of Patent: July 21, 2015
    Assignee: Wayne Fueling Systems LLC
    Inventors: Timothy Martin Weston, Weiming Tang
  • Publication number: 20140334547
    Abstract: In video motion estimation an initial candidate motion vector is generated for each block and a vector error is determined as for example a DFD. Spatial gradients of pixel values are calculated and used to refine the initial candidate motion vector. The relative contribution of the spatial gradients to the refinement process depends on the vector error.
    Type: Application
    Filed: May 12, 2014
    Publication date: November 13, 2014
    Inventors: Michael James Knee, Martin Weston
  • Publication number: 20140289133
    Abstract: A multimode system for receiving data in a retail environment includes: a secure input module for receiving high security input and low security input from a customer, the high security input to be communicated by the secure input module in cipher text, and the low security input to be communicated by the secure input module in plaintext. The multimode system is adapted to operate in a high security mode and a low security mode. The multimode system is adapted to enter the low security mode upon detection by the multimode system of a security breach condition. In the high security mode, the secure input module accepts low security input and high security input. In the low security mode, the secure input module accepts the low security input and does not accept the high security input.
    Type: Application
    Filed: June 6, 2014
    Publication date: September 25, 2014
    Inventors: Timothy Martin Weston, Weiming Tang, David Spiller
  • Patent number: 8788428
    Abstract: Embodiments of a multimode system for use in, for example, a fuel dispenser, are configured for receiving data in a retail environment. The multimode system can include: a secure input module for receiving high security input and low security input from a customer, the high security input to be communicated by the secure input module in cipher text, and the low security input to be communicated by the secure input module in plaintext. The multimode system is adapted to operate in a high security mode and a low security mode. The multimode system is adapted to enter the low security mode upon detection by the multimode system of a security breach condition. In the high security mode, the secure input module accepts low security input and high security input. In the low security mode, the secure input module accepts the low security input and does not accept the high security input.
    Type: Grant
    Filed: June 28, 2011
    Date of Patent: July 22, 2014
    Assignee: Dresser, Inc.
    Inventors: Timothy Martin Weston, Weiming Tang, David Spiller
  • Patent number: 8781259
    Abstract: An image or other sample processor has a resampling filter adapted to provide output samples at an output sampling frequency which can be selected to be higher or lower than the input sampling frequency. The width of the resampling filter aperture is scaled according to either the input sampling frequency or the output sampling frequency so as to obtain the wider of the two possible filter apertures.
    Type: Grant
    Filed: October 15, 2012
    Date of Patent: July 15, 2014
    Assignee: Snell Limited
    Inventor: Martin Weston
  • Patent number: 8773586
    Abstract: Systems and methods of rendering a motion image. Input temporal image-samples are temporally interpolated to create the output sequence and an intentional, periodic motion-judder component that is visible when the output temporal image-samples are displayed is introduced.
    Type: Grant
    Filed: April 22, 2013
    Date of Patent: July 8, 2014
    Assignee: Snell Limited
    Inventor: Martin Weston
  • Publication number: 20130265499
    Abstract: In for example the assignment of motion vectors, an array of pixel-to-pixel dissimilarity values is analysed to identify a pixel which has a low pixel-to-pixel dissimilarity value and which has neighbouring pixels which have a low pixel-to-pixel dissimilarity value. The pixel-to-pixel dissimilarity values are filtered with a filter aperture decomposed into two or more sectors with partial filters applied respectively to each sector. Outputs of the partial filters are combining by a non-linear operation, for example taking the minimum from diametrically opposed sectors.
    Type: Application
    Filed: March 15, 2013
    Publication date: October 10, 2013
    Applicant: SNELL LIMITED
    Inventors: Michael James Knee, Martin Weston
  • Publication number: 20130229573
    Abstract: Systems and methods of rendering a motion image. Input temporal image-samples are temporally interpolated to create the output sequence and an intentional, periodic motion-judder component that is visible when the output temporal image-samples are displayed is introduced.
    Type: Application
    Filed: April 22, 2013
    Publication date: September 5, 2013
    Applicant: Snell Limited
    Inventor: Martin Weston
  • Patent number: 8515205
    Abstract: When mixing cutting between video cameras viewing a common scene from different viewpoints, geometric transforms that vary from image to image are applied to one or both camera outputs so as to create an apparent point of view that moves along on a path joining the viewpoints of the cameras.
    Type: Grant
    Filed: July 23, 2009
    Date of Patent: August 20, 2013
    Assignee: Snell Limited
    Inventors: Martin Weston, James Pearson
  • Patent number: 8502705
    Abstract: A device for entering information securely in a customer transaction is described. The device may include a keypad comprising a set of full travel keys for transmitting a first set of data and a set of minimal travel keys for transmitting a second set of data. A subset of the full travel keys may be operable to receive numerical entries, and a subset of the minimal travel keys may be customized to perform one or more nonnumeric functions. A controller is connected to and receives data from one or more components of the keypad. The device may be used in a fuel dispenser system or another environment where a customer transaction occurs.
    Type: Grant
    Filed: June 28, 2007
    Date of Patent: August 6, 2013
    Assignee: Dresser, Inc.
    Inventors: Randal Scott Kretzler, Timothy Martin Weston
  • Patent number: 8477242
    Abstract: First image data at a lower sampling frequency is up-sampled in a sampling ratio N:M to a higher sampling frequency in an up-sampling filter; and, second image data at the said higher sampling frequency is down-sampled in a sampling ratio M:N to the said lower sampling frequency in a down-sampling filter where the combination of the up-sampling filter and the down-sampling filter is substantially transparent and every filtered sample is formed from a weighted sum of at least two input samples.
    Type: Grant
    Filed: May 15, 2009
    Date of Patent: July 2, 2013
    Assignee: Snell Limited
    Inventor: Martin Weston